- The distance between Newkirk, Ok, Usa and Koutia, Mali is approximately 9,317 km or 5,790 mi.
- To reach Newkirk, Ok in this distance one would set out from Koutia bearing 306.6°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Newkirk, Ok bearing 259.2° or W .
- Newkirk, Ok has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Koutia has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Newkirk, Ok is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Koutia is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 11.9 °C (21.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.4 °C (34.9°F) more in Newkirk, Ok.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 10.2 mm (0.4 in) less which is equivalent to 10.2 l/m² (0.25 US gal/ft²) or 102,000 l/ha (10,904 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.8° lower in Newkirk, Ok than in Koutia.
